        "content": "<p>President, VP seek full campaign schedule<\/p>\n<p>Fabiola Desy Unidjaja, The Jakarta Post, Jakarta<\/p>\n<p>Despite the rigid campaign ruling issued by the General Election<br>\nCommission (KPU), President Megawati Soekarnoputri and Vice<br>\nPresident Hamzah Haz will be allowed to campaign for their<br>\nrespective parties any day they desire during the 20-day election<br>\nperiod starting on March 11.<\/p>\n<p>Of greater concern to some citizens is whether there will be a<br>\npower vacuum while the President and the Vice President are out<br>\nin the provinces focused on party issues, and neglecting national<br>\nissues in Jakarta. This arrangement was decided upon during a<br>\nlimited Cabinet meeting presided over by Megawati at the State<br>\nPalace here on Friday.<\/p>\n<p>Home Minister Hari Sabarno reiterated after the meeting that<br>\nMegawati and Hamzah were given the green light to campaign for<br>\ntheir parties -- on their own holiday time -- because there is no<br>\nregulation on vacations for the country&apos;s two top officials.<\/p>\n<p>He said the President and the Vice President would have to<br>\ncoordinate their schedules so that one was always in the capital<br>\nduring the campaign season.<\/p>\n<p>&quot;Based on that reasoning, the two top state officials could<br>\narrange their own schedule for the legislative election campaign<br>\nprovided that at least one of them is present in the capital each<br>\nday during the campaign season,&quot; he said.<\/p>\n<p>Chapter 37 of KPU Regulation No. 701\/2003 stipulates that<br>\nstate officials with political parties, including the President<br>\nand Vice President are prohibited from using state facilities<br>\nduring the campaign period, required to take unpaid leave and<br>\nmust hand over their party&apos;s campaign schedule of events to KPU<br>\nseven days before they campaign.<\/p>\n<p>State officials in the judiciary, from the central bank, the<br>\nSupreme Audit Agency, state-owned companies, career government<br>\nofficials and village heads are prohibited from being involved in<br>\nelection campaigns.<\/p>\n<p>Hari said the preparation of a government regulation on<br>\nelection campaigning for state officials with political parties<br>\nhas already been completed and would be officially issued before<br>\nMegawati left for Iran on Tuesday.<\/p>\n<p>Megawati hopes that she can campaign for her Indonesian<br>\nDemocratic Party of Struggle (PDI-P) as well as she did in 1999,<br>\nwhen PDI-P was the top vote-getter, in order that the party can<br>\ncontrol as much of the legislature as possible. Hamzah in his<br>\ncapacity as chairman of the United Development Party (PPP) will<br>\nmake use of the campaign season in bid to improve his party&apos;s<br>\nperformance in the elections, despite a major split since 1999<br>\nled by Zainuddin M.Z. to set up the Reform Star Party. PPP<br>\nfinished in the top three in 1999.<\/p>\n<p>Other state officials from political parties, including<br>\nministers, governors, regents and mayors are required to take<br>\nofficial leave.<\/p>\n<p>From the Cabinet, 14 ministers will take leave to be<br>\ncampaigners during the campaign season, and possibly two will<br>\nresign to run as candidates.<\/p>",
